HIGH EFFICIENCY REEFER DECK DESIGN FOR CARGO SHIPS: REFRIGERATED COMPARTMENT COMPOSITE DECK

US Joiner, LLC brought together a team of innovative US composite and insulation manufacturers to design a large refrigerator floor area, reefer deck. Conventional construction of the deck was too heavy and consumed too much of the deck to deck height. The design significantly reduced the weight of the vessel, increased thermal resistance, and reduced the deck thickness from seven (7) inches to three (3) inches. The insulation which contacts the steel deck is changed from a combustible material to a noncombustible material, thereby increasing fire safety. The paper describes the design.
